Hello everyone, and welcome to the Student-Tutor Podcast!

 

What does it REALLY take for students to do incredible things like competing in the World Olympic Games? Is it just a dream, or
is there a path they can take to get there?

Carli Ellen Lloyd (28) is an American indoor volleyball player, a member of the United States women's national volleyball team, a participant of the 2016 Summer Olympics, bronze medalist of the 2016 Olympic Games, and a gold medalist of the 2015 Pan American Games.

She has played 6 seasons of professional volleyball in Italy and Azerbaijan. She played college women's volleyball at the University of California, Berkeley and was the National player of the year her senior year in 2011.

This week, Carli Ellen Lloyd shares what it took to earn a spot on the USA national volleyball team, and how students can use her strategies for success in all aspects of their day-to-day life!

3 Key Points:

 

1. Focus on the little goals and tasks that make up your big goal.

It can be daunting to think about what you need to do on a major scale... instead, commit to doing all that you can do TODAY!

2. Take control, and be willing to put in the hard work!

When you're defeated, focus on what you CAN control!

3. Understand your WHY, and SHARE IT!

Connecting to your core will help you push through the hardest times. By sharing, your friends can help hold you accountable.
